The Safe Harvest action plan begins with security measures in the province of Biobío, Chile

Wheat
Published Dec 30, 2022

Tridge summary

Various authorities came to the Mulchén commune to initiate the “Safe Harvest” action plan, which, in its fourth session, during the year 2022, considered coordination and security measures for the province of Biobío.

Original content

The Provincial Presidential delegate, Paulina Purrán, in the company of the Senator of the Republic, Gastón Saavedra, the mayor of Mulchén, Jorge Rivas, the Agriculture Seremi, Pamela Yáñez, representatives of the Agricultural Society of Biobío (SOCABIO), participated in the event. teams from the National Forestry Corporation (CONAF), Investigative Police (PDI), Carabineros and the Chilean Army. "It was now the official launch of this campaign, after its fourth session of this program, with the farmers and also with all the security teams, be it the Army, Carabineros, PDI, municipality, Agriculture and CONAF, with the intention of preventing fires. harvest season or any event that will affect harvest processes, both for the province and at the national level", commented the provincial delegate, Paulina Purrán.
